设计说明书 基于ARM的超声波测距计数仪.pdfVIP

  • 18
  • 0
  • 约3.78万字
  • 约 25页
  • 2021-06-18 发布于天津
  • 举报

设计说明书 基于ARM的超声波测距计数仪.pdf

基于 ARM 的超声波测距计数仪 目 录 前言 3 第 1 章 超声波测距原理 4 第 1.1 节 超声波的介绍 4 第 1.2 节 超声波测距的方法 4 第 1.3 节 超声波计数的方法 5 第 2 章 系统的总体设计 6 第 2.1 节 测距方案的选 6 第 2.2 节 微处理器的选 6 第 2.3 节 编程语言的选 7 第 3 章 系统硬件设计8 第 3.1 节 超声波发射与接收电路 8 第 3.2 节 Open103Z 的电路8 第 3.3 节 Open103Z 开发板接口与超声波的接口电路9 第 4 章 系统软件设计 11 第 4.1 节 主程序设计总体思路 11 第 4.2 节 超声波测距算法设计 11 第 4.3 节 超声波计数算法设计 12 第 4.4 节 系统的中断处理 12 第 5 章 系统测 15 第 5.1 节 测试任务与目标 15 第 5.2 节 测试方案 15 第 5.3 节 测试结果 15 结论16 参考文献17 致谢 17 附录18 附录 1:实物照片说明18 附录 2:部分源程序18 - i - 基于 ARM 的超声波测距计数仪 【摘要】:超声波测距计数仪是用来统计景区的进出人数。论文介绍了基于ARM 控 制的超声测距计数的原理:由 Open103ZE 控制定时器产生超声波脉冲并计时,计算超声 波自发射至接收的往返时间,从而得到实测距离。根据检测到的距离来判断是否有人经 过超声波,开始计数。同时根据返回来的数据用 LCD 显示屏将测得的距离与计数显示出 来。 根据要实现的功能设计了系统的总体方案,整个硬件电路由超声波发射电路、超声 波接收电路、电源电路、显示电路等模块组成。各探头的信号经 ARM 综合分析处理,实 现超声波测距仪的各种功能。最后通过硬件和软件实现了各个功能模块。相关部分附有 硬件电路图、程序流程图,给出了系统构成、电路原理及程序设计。此系统具有易控 制、工作可靠、测距准确度高、可读性强和流程清晰等优点。实现后的作品可用于需要 测量距离参数的各种应用场合。 【关键词】:ARM;超声波;测距计数; 第 1 页 [Abstract]: Ranging counting system is designed to statistics of the number of people entering the scenic design. The principle of ultrasonic distance measurement based on ARM controlled counting: Ultrasonic pulse generated by the Open103ZE control timer and timer, calculated from the ultrasonic transmitter to the receiver of the round-trip time, resulting in the measured distance. According to the detected distance to determine whether someone is subjected to ultrasonic starts counting. According to the data returned while the measured distance and count displayed by the LCD display. The hardware circuit by the ultrasonic transmitter,

文档评论(0)

1亿VIP精品文档

相关文档